Description:

Located across the highway from the Gulf of Mexico and sand beaches, Cajun RV has long been a place we visit when in the Biloxi, MS area. It is centrally located with a short drive to the local Casinos and restaurants. There is a very active highway at the entrance to the park and a train track at the rear of the park so you will not have a quiet experience, but we found it not too bad and quickly got used to it.


This is a fairly large park with about 130 sites. Pull through and back in sites are available. The sites vary quite a lot in size and distance from your neighbor. The RV park is built on what used to be a double drive in theater many years ago when I was a kid which really helps make the ground level and very stable. The office, community room, showers and bathrooms are located in what used to be the concession stand and projector tower for the Drive in. The showers have been updated and have secure code controlled doors. The bathroom and showers are well maintained and cleaned daily. After 9:00 in the morning there are breakfast items and coffee available in the large community room.


All the lots are grass, sand, or gravel so I do recommend you have an outside rug to reduce the dirt you have tracked in. There are picnic tables at the sites. At our site, the water and power connections were well maintained and worked properly. There is a location at the park to store RV's.


The staff is extremely helpful and seem to genuinely care if you enjoy the park. We were in a bit of a jam due to a potential hurricane back at our base and may have needed to leave early or stay longer depending on the storm. The staff made quick arrangements so that if we had to stay, we would not have to move sites and we did not have to pay anything extra to have the contingency.


We both recommend a stay at Cajun RV Park. Just be aware it is a bit older, but we always enjoy it.
